The term inference engine is firmly anchored in the fields of artificial intelligence, automation, big data and smart data. An inference engine is a central element of many AI systems. It helps to derive new information or decisions from existing data.
You can think of an inference engine as the thinking centre of an AI: It analyses data and rules that are available to it and draws conclusions from them. For example, an inference engine in online retail uses customer data and product information to decide which items to suggest to a buyer next.
Inference engines also play a major role in Industry 4.0. They can analyse machine data and predict when maintenance is required before a malfunction occurs - saving time and money. The decisive factor here is that the inference engine automates and accelerates decision-making processes because it processes large volumes of data at lightning speed.
Whether for recommendation management, in smart factories or when analysing large data sets - modern artificial intelligence would often be inconceivable without the inference engine.